adult frontal nerve

ID: FBbt_00100330

Adult Nervous system Neuron projection bundle

The adult frontal nerve contains a variety of fibers, largely from interneurons, and connects the tritocerebrum and the frontal ganglion (an unpaired structure on the anterior side of the esophagus) (Ito et al., 2014. It is fused with the labral nerve to form the labro-frontal nerve (Ito et al., 2014. (Ito et al., 2014)
